A disc brake self-priming cooling structure
A disc brake and cooling structure technology, applied in the direction of brake type, brake components, mechanical equipment, etc., can solve the problems of reduced cooling efficiency of brake components, lack of cooling of auxiliary brake blocks, etc., and achieve the effect of improving brake cooling efficiency

[0016] Such as figure 1 As shown, a disc brake self-priming cooling structure includes an axle 10, a brake disc 11 and a brake caliper 1; a brake cylinder 2 is installed on the front arm of the brake caliper 1, and the end of the brake cylinder 2 is connected to There is a main brake block 3, and an auxiliary brake block 12 is installed on the rear arm of the brake caliper 1;
